当前位置: 首页 > 软件教程 > 超简单的VBS代码来恶搞朋友的电脑

超简单的VBS代码来恶搞朋友的电脑

2024-12-03 来源:bjmtth 编辑:佚名

在这个数字化时代,技术不仅能够帮助我们提高工作效率,还能成为一种创意十足的娱乐方式。今天,我们就来聊聊如何利用一些简单的小技巧,让你的朋友在享受科技乐趣的同时,也能感受到来自你的特别问候。请注意,本文提供的所有内容仅用于娱乐和学习目的,请确保得到对方同意后再进行操作。

一、让桌面图标疯狂跳舞

想要给朋友一个惊喜吗?试试这个简单的vbs脚本吧!它可以让桌面上的所有图标开始“跳舞”。只需复制以下代码到记事本中,保存为`.vbs`文件(例如,命名为`dancing_icons.vbs`),然后发送给你的朋友。

```vbscript

set objshell = createobject("wscript.shell")

set objfolder = objshell.specialfolders("desktop")

set objfolderitem = objfolder.self

strpath = objfolderitem.path

set objshell = createobject("shell.application")

set objfolder = objshell.namespace(strpath)

for each objfolderitem in objfolder.items

objfolderitem.invokeverb("properties")

next

```

运行这个脚本后,朋友们可能会发现他们的图标突然变得非常活跃,但实际上这只是因为它们被打开了一次属性窗口而已。不过,这已经足够制造出一种“图标在动”的错觉了!

二、设置闹钟提醒时间倒流

如果你觉得上面的方法还不够有趣,那么不妨试试这个闹钟脚本。通过设置一个定时提醒,告诉他们时间正在倒流,绝对能让人捧腹大笑。

```vbscript

set objshell = createobject("wscript.shell")

inthours = hour(now) - 1 ⁄'减少一小时

intminutes = minute(now)

intseconds = second(now)

objshell.run "mshta.exe vbscript:execute(""msgbox """"时间倒流啦!现在是" & inthours & ":" & intminutes & ":" & intseconds & """",64,""时间倒流提醒""):close""")

```

这段代码会弹出一个消息框,显示一个虚假的时间信息。当然,这只是一个玩笑,并不会真正改变系统时间。

三、终极恶搞:鼠标指针大逃亡

最后一个技巧将会把恶搞推向高潮——让鼠标的指针消失得无影无踪。这对于习惯依赖鼠标的朋友来说,绝对是一场不小的挑战。

```vbscript

set objshell = createobject("wscript.shell")

objshell.run "rundll32 user32.dll,lockworkstation"

```

虽然这段代码实际上会锁定计算机屏幕,但你可以稍微修改一下,比如隐藏鼠标指针而不锁屏,这样就能达到让鼠标指针“逃走”的效果。

结语

通过上述几个简单的vbs脚本,你不仅可以增加与朋友之间的互动乐趣,同时也能展示自己对编程和技术的理解。记住,无论何时何地,保持幽默感都是人际交往中的重要元素之一。希望这些创意能够为你带来灵感,让你的朋友也能在忙碌的生活之余找到一丝轻松和欢笑。

请记得,在使用这些脚本时一定要考虑到对方的感受,并且确保这种恶作剧是在双方都乐于接受的情况下进行的。

类似合集
更多+

Copyright@2014-2024 All Rights Reserved 鄂ICP备2021009302号-5 麦田下载站 版权所有